Dr. Ehsan Arabzadeh is a health scientist and researcher currently serving as Director of Research at Histogenotech Company, Tehran, Iran, with an academic background deeply rooted in exercise physiology and sports sciences. He earned his Bachelor’s degree in Physical Education and Sport Sciences from Ferdowsi University of Mashhad (2011), followed by a Master’s in Exercise Physiology from the University of Mazandaran (2013), and later completed his Ph.D. in Exercise Physiology at Urmia University (2018), where he was recognized as an Exceptional Talent scholar by the Iranian National Elite Foundation. His research focuses on molecular and cellular exercise physiology, exercise biochemistry, clinical exercise physiology, and the therapeutic role of herbal and nano-supplement interventions, with significant contributions to understanding cardiokines, myokines, adipokines, oxidative stress, neurodegeneration, and metabolic disorders. Dr. Arabzadeh has authored and co-authored numerous publications in high-impact journals such as Nutrition, Pflügers Archiv-European Journal of Physiology, Biogerontology, Gene, and Journal of Food Biochemistry, where his studies explored exercise’s role in liver disease, cardiovascular function, skeletal muscle adaptation, and neuroprotection. His scientific excellence has been recognized through prestigious honors, including membership in the Iranian National Elite Foundation (awarded to less than 0.3% of Iranian students) and the Shahid Tehrani Moghaddam Award in 2019, alongside sporting achievements such as silver medals in national badminton competitions. In addition to his research, Dr. Arabzadeh has teaching experience at Urmia and Mazandaran Universities and serves on editorial and peer-review boards of several scientific journals, further contributing to advancing the fields of exercise physiology and health sciences. He has 267 citations from 43 documents with an h-index of 10.
